Rehearsals begin for THE SHEPHERD’S LIFE

CcfN88TWIAAGgATRehearsals began this week for THE SHEPHERD’S LIFE at Theatre by the Lake in Keswick.

Week 1 will be taken up with looking at the text with Writer and Director, Chris Monks, and working with the fabulous puppeteer, Jimmy Grimes.

PETITION AGAINST PARKING CHARGE RISE IN KESWICK

petitionThe battle against plans for a major hike in parking charges in Keswick hotted up today when a petition with 3,912 signatures was delivered to Allerdale Borough Council.
Rachel Swift, Head of Marketing, took the petition, organised by the theatre, Keswick Retailers Association and Lake District Hotels, to the council’s offices in Workington.
“The petition has been signed on line and on paper by a staggering number of people,” said Rachel. “When coupled with the 94 pages of comments that people have left when signing the petition – it’s a very clear sign of the anger people feel about these ill-thought out charges.
